taken from the readme.txt which is included in the zip file
/System/Library/Frameworks/AddressBook.framework
Change the stock ABAddressFormats.plist to ABAddressFormats.plist.OLD and copy the patched one here. Rename ABAddressFormats(MOD).plist to ABAddressFormats.plist. Reboot the phone for the changes to take effect.
